Rancilio Silvia M

The Rancilio Silvia espresso machine is an espresso machine with a single boiler that makes traditional espresso with great taste. It's an excellent entry-level espresso maker for home baristas and it's built to last for an extended time. It's a great option for those interested in learning how to make espresso.

The machine is built to a very high standard and comes with a number of professional features that are not usually found in machines in this price range. For instance, it comes with a robust chrome-plated portafilter, as well as two commercial-sized 58mm filter baskets. These are the same dimensions as those used on Rancilio's professional espresso machines, which makes it easy to follow recipes that were developed on commercial equipment. It also comes with an stainless steel steam wand that's articulated and capable of generating microfoam that is cafe-standard.

The components made of metal on Silvia's components made of metal Silvia are durable, as opposed to other machines of the entry-level category from Breville and Gaggia. Its brewgroup is made of solid brass and it has the largest boiler on the market. This allows it to achieve greater temperature stability as well as faster recovery times. It also has a a heavy duty 3 way group solenoid that helps to keep water pressure from back-pressure.

The Silvia can be a bit finicky at times, and can be demanding, but it rewards the barista who is patient with excellent espresso shots. It is able to rival machines that cost nearly two and two-and-a-half times as much. It's not a good choice for people who are just beginning, as they may not have the patience or expertise to handle all of its specific requirements. It's also not a good choice for those looking for an espresso drink in a hurry to start their day. It's Best espresso machine for those who want to become a master barista and are prepared to invest in the time and money needed to master this unique technique of brewing.

Gaggia Classic Pro

Aimed at the home barista Gaggia's take on a classic that's been around for a long time. It's not as sleek as its contemporary competitors but it is still an attractive, functional machine that will make a statement in your kitchen. The stainless steel body is strong and the brewing head is made of brass. This will ensure that your coffee will be at the perfect temperature throughout the entire process. The Classic Pro has a three way solenoid valve to ensure constant water pressure inside the filter holder. The valve also takes out any remaining steam or water when the brewing process has been completed.

Another aspect that the Classic Pro has that its older counterparts didn't is the commercial-style steam wand which can be used to make the silky, rich microfoam needed for latte art. The Classic Pro also has rocker switches that let you choose between steaming or brewing as well as indicator lights that inform you when the machine is ready to use.

While this machine doesn't provide temperature or pressure adjustments as some of its competitors, it is fairly simple to install and use for novice baristas. It's also much cheaper than a professional espresso maker, and can aid in learning before you move on to more sophisticated machines.

Gaggia's website provides a range of tips and tricks making use of this machine, including an instruction guide to get the most out of the espresso experience. Additionally, there are a number of forums online that will walk you through pressure and temperature adjustment but they are geared towards more experienced tinkerers and can cause damage to the warranty. Regardless the situation, the Classic Pro is still an excellent espresso machine that will give you results that will rival the Best filter coffee machine Milan's coffee bars.

Diletta Mio

The Diletta Mio is a solid option for those who want to make top-quality coffee without breaking the bank. It is designed to be energy efficient and has minimal heat loss from its well-regulated heater configurations. A single boiler equipped with a PID lets you to adjust brewing settings depending on the beans you've chosen and coffee roast.

The Mio also stands out in terms of performance, with its consistent, reliable results, and its powerful 15-bar system that is ideal for brewing high quality espresso. This is due to the fact that the boiler is placed directly above the brew group, which results in minimal thermal losses between the boiler and the puck surface.

The integrated milk frother is another feature that makes Diletta Mio apart. It allows you to create cafe-quality cappuccinos and lattes with just a single button press. This is a significant convenience for those who don't need or want to use separate milk frothing equipment.
